Who We Are
Jan and Rick Hemphill have been involved in missions in Kenya for over 11 years. The first time they visited Kenya, God called them to serve Him and to help the people of the Mutiini Church located in the Rift Valley near Mount Mutiini. They have started many ministries at the church, including a Feeding Program that feeds lunch daily to seniors in the community and preschool children; a Weekend Feeding Program giving the seniors food for the weekend; and distribution of Bibles to the members of the church and the surrounding community.
The School Sponsorship Program, HOPE for Kenya’s Kids, will provide school for around 50 children.
